According to the Office for National Statistics, the total number of 16-17 year olds is down slightly from a peak of nearly 1.6 million in 2008. The figures are approximate over the whole country and it is impossible to calculate how many in any one constituency.
What we do know is that 18-24 year olds were in general very opposed to Brexit and are the age bracket most enthusiastic about Jeremy Corbyn.
